ADIC Reports Sales of $90 Million in First Quarter as Annual Growth Exceeds 41 Percent
First Quarter Earnings Reach $8.7 Million, or 16 Cents Per Share
REDMOND, Wash.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Feb. 14, 2001--Advanced Digital Information Corporation (Nasdaq:ADIC - news) today announced sales grew 41 percent to $90.1 million for the first quarter ended Jan. 31, 2001, versus sales of $63.9 million for the same period a year ago.

Earnings were $8.7 million, or 16 cents per diluted share, for the quarter as compared to $7.2 million, or 13 cents per diluted share, for the first quarter of fiscal 2000.

``Revenue growth was exceptional this quarter as OEM sales grew by nearly $20 million over levels in the fourth quarter reflecting the ramp up of sales to IBM and continued strength among existing OEM customers,'' commented Chairman and Chief Executive Officer Peter van Oppen.

``We diverted production and engineering resources to support OEM demand but opportunities for both branded and OEM business remain robust,'' he said. Total OEM revenue was 45 percent of sales versus 28 percent of sales in the previous period.
